Why are torque specs important for head gasket?
Why are torque specs important for head gasket? Manufacturers provide torque specifications to guide mechanics in properly tightening the bolts connecting the cylinder heads to the main engine. Improper tightening of the bolts on a cylinder head results in uneven distribution of tension across both the bolts and the head gasket. What kind of bolts do I need to change my head gasket?
